Default GS-R and B20 Vtec Head Studs The Same???

I just bought a set of head studs from lightning motorsports for a b20 with a b16a head and they sent me some for a b18c. I called them back and asked them about it, and they said that they are the same. I even asked why they had different part numbers, and he assured me that they were the same regardless. So now im askin everyone else are they the same??? I dont want to wait til the last minute and have to track a set down.

they should be fine, b20 b18b and b18c all have the same deck height. its the b16 ones you shouldnt use. anyway people have been using those for some time for b20vtecs HOWEVER, i dont honestly know if the b20 block / b16a head studs are indeed the same or different like lighting says.

ARP finally released a ls/b20 vtec kit a little while back but up intill then we all had to use the GRS/B16 arp studs. You will be fine with the "vtec" studs -
